Rats & Bullies - A Full-Length Documentary Feature
The life and death of Dawn-Marie Wesley is explored in this documentary film which shows how the more subtle forms of bullying exhibited by teen females can have the harshest of results.

Dawn-Marie Wesley took her own life after experiencing a cycle of
psychological abuse and verbal threats from some of her closest acquaintances.
Distinctions are made between the more well known types of bullying that males
engage in and the more mysterious ways in which females bully.
In RATS
& BULLIES you will journey to a small town in British Columbia, Canada and
hear first hand accounts from family members, a best friend, a judge, a mother
of another child who was headed down the same path as Dawn-Marie, a former
mayor, one of the bullies who was prosecuted, and others.
RATS &
BULLIES shows you not only the bullying events which led to Dawn-Marie's
decision, but also the aftermath: the effect of this loss of life on the
victim's family and friends, the community and even the accused. You will also
learn of Restorative Justice and how Aboriginal Law played a poignant and
powerful role in the punishment of Dawn-Marie's tormentors.
